Member Benefits

As a MetSkill member company you will receive:

  • Training: all training programmes offered through MetSkill are developed by the industry for the industry according to best practice and recognised industry standards. To start with, we can offer your company a training needs analysis, focussing on your priority business issues that have an impact on skills needs in your business.

  • Employer steering groups: members lead employer steering groups to ensure that every product meets the exacting standards of the industry, is up to date with current legislation and is delivering tangible business benefits in companies.

  • Cost reductions: as a member, your business will receive significant discounts on all MetSkill programmes, including apprenticeships, as soon as you join. See our latest product literature and price list for full details.

  • Source of Funding: members get exclusive information and advice on sources of funding available locally to support training activities. We can also sort out any funding applications and paperwork that can be too complex and time-consuming to deal with in-house.

  • Influence: being part of a Sector Skills Council, we are constantly campaigning on behalf of our sector to improve the quality and availability of education and skills provision across the UK. SEMTA works closely with Government Departments, Learning and Skills Councils, Regional Development Agencies, Local Education Authorities and many other public bodies to ensure the needs of our sector are understood and catered for wherever possible.

  • Health and safety: Passport schemes make sure your employees are certified competent, which can have a positive effect on your Employer Liability insurance premiums and lost time due to accidents and associated costs.

  • Information: A monthly bulletin with updates on all products, services and funding information will automatically be sent to you.

  • Advice: Provision of day-to-day advice and guidance on skills issues, training provision and funding from our dedicated Employer Services Team.

  • Networking meetings: Networking meetings are held in order to update members with any significant changes to funding or products, and also to gain your feedback about what you would like us to offer in the future.

  • Discounts on selected events – MetSkill is currently working closely with The Manufacturer and can offer discounts on joint events and subscription rates.
